12S17V12

وَجَعَلۡنَا ٱلَّيۡلَ وَٱلنَّهَارَ ءَايَتَيۡنِۖ فَمَحَوۡنَآ ءَايَةَ ٱلَّيۡلِ وَجَعَلۡنَآ ءَايَةَ ٱلنَّهَارِ مُبۡصِرَةٗ لِّتَبۡتَغُواْ فَضۡلٗا مِّن رَّبِّكُمۡ وَلِتَعۡلَمُواْ عَدَدَ ٱلسِّنِينَ وَٱلۡحِسَابَۚ وَكُلَّ شَيۡءٖ فَصَّلۡنَٰهُ تَفۡصِيلٗا

Nous avons fait de la nuit et du jour deux signes, et Nous avons effacé le signe de la nuit, tandis que Nous avons rendu visible le signe du jour, pour que vous recherchiez des grâces de votre Seigneur, et que vous sachiez le nombre des années et le calcul du temps. Et Nous avons expliqué toute chose d'une manière détaillée

Al-JalalaynAl-Jalalayn

And We made the night and the day two signs both indicators of Our power. Then We effaced the sign of the night extinguishing its light with darkness so that you might repose therein the annexation āyata’layli ‘the sign of the night’ is explicative and made the sign of the day sight-giving in other words one in which it is possible to see because of the light; that you may seek therein bounty from your Lord by earning your livelihood and that you may know by both day and night the number of years and the reckoning of the times of the day and everything that might be needed We have detailed very distinctly We have explained clearly.

13S17V13

وَكُلَّ إِنسَٰنٍ أَلۡزَمۡنَٰهُ طَـٰٓئِرَهُۥ فِي عُنُقِهِۦۖ وَنُخۡرِجُ لَهُۥ يَوۡمَ ٱلۡقِيَٰمَةِ كِتَٰبٗا يَلۡقَىٰهُ مَنشُورًا

Et au cou de chaque homme, Nous avons attaché son œuvre. Et au Jour de la Résurrection, Nous lui sortirons un écrit qu'il trouvera déroulé

Al-JalalaynAl-Jalalayn

And We have attached every person’s omen — his deeds — for him to carry upon his neck — this site is singled out for mention because fastening something to it is much more severe; Mujāhid b. Jabr al-Makkī said ‘There is not a child born but it has a leaf around its neck in which it is decreed that the child will be either fortunate or damned’ — and We shall bring forth for him on the Day of Resurrection a book in which his deeds are recorded and which he will find wide open yalqāhu manshūran both are adjectival qualifications of kitāban ‘a book’.

15S17V15

مَّنِ ٱهۡتَدَىٰ فَإِنَّمَا يَهۡتَدِي لِنَفۡسِهِۦۖ وَمَن ضَلَّ فَإِنَّمَا يَضِلُّ عَلَيۡهَاۚ وَلَا تَزِرُ وَازِرَةٞ وِزۡرَ أُخۡرَىٰۗ وَمَا كُنَّا مُعَذِّبِينَ حَتَّىٰ نَبۡعَثَ رَسُولٗا

Quiconque prend le droit chemin ne le prend que pour lui-même; et quiconque s'égare, ne s'égare qu'à son propre détriment. Et nul ne portera le fardeau d'autrui. Et Nous n'avons jamais puni [un peuple] avant de [lui] avoir envoyé un Messager

Al-JalalaynAl-Jalalayn

Whoever is guided is guided only to the good of his own soul because the reward of his guidance will be for him; and whoever goes astray goes astray only to its his soul’s detriment because the sin thereof will be held against it. No burdened no sinful soul shall bear the burden of another soul. And We never chastise anyone until We have sent a messenger to make clear to him that which is his obligation.
